Transaction 20c335b72667762d44af8c997e0d2b87ef48c885e0d7cbb7a43a5cf7ba77fcea

2 Input
2 Outputs
  • 20c335b72667762d44af8c997e0d2b87ef48c885e0d7cbb7a43a5cf7ba77fcea:0
  • value  2387681
    address  1JNNasVJxsZRKVCG8XcvhjJ8AJqPYK39pc
  • 20c335b72667762d44af8c997e0d2b87ef48c885e0d7cbb7a43a5cf7ba77fcea:1
  • value  2437877
    address  33ufbYsLMFgUH913XQtY2YNYRbarvwPqWz